How to Choose a Single Carport Kit
Measure the vehicle with doors open, not only the body width. Add space for posts, footings, drainage and a comfortable walking path, then compare the overall product dimensions. Planning a Single Carport Kit for an Australian Site
- Measure the full area: include posts, footings, roof projection and operating clearance.
- Check access: allow for vehicles, doors, gates, freight delivery and installation handling.
- Review services: locate drainage, underground services and any regulated electrical, gas or plumbing work.
- Confirm approvals: requirements vary by council, property and structure dimensions.

Single Carport Kit FAQs
How wide should a single carport be?
Use the actual vehicle width with the doors open and include the post positions shown for the kit. The product dimensions and site boundaries should determine the final choice.
What should I measure before ordering single carport kits australia for one-vehicle bays?
Record the overall footprint, height, access path, post or fixing positions and any doors, windows, eaves or services nearby. Compare those measurements with the exact product configuration, not only the collection title.
Do I need council or building approval?
Requirements vary by state, council, property zoning, dimensions and installation method. Check with the relevant local authority before purchasing and use our council approval guide as a general starting point.
Can I install the kit myself?
Some kits use modular components, but the required skills, tools and lifting support vary. Follow the product instructions and use qualified or licensed trades where structural, electrical, gas or plumbing work requires them.
